CVE-2021-47232
CVE-2021-47232 affects the Linux kernel CAN/J1939 subsystem. The root cause is a Use‑After‑Free caused by taking a skb from the per‑session skb queue without incrementing its refcount, which can occur concurrently due to CTS. The vulnerability of the btrfs_get_root_ref() function in the fs/btrfs/disk-io.c file of the Linux kernel’s file system allows a hacker to cause a service failure.
The vulnerability of the btrfsgetrootref function in the fs/btrfs/disk-io.c file of the Linux kernel’s file system is related to the repeated release of a reserved memory block. Exploiting this vulnerability could allow an attacker to cause a service failure...
